Ventavis (iloprost) is an inhaled prostacyclin analog approved for the treatment of pulmonary arterial hypertension (PAH) in adults with NYHA Class III or IV symptoms to improve exercise tolerance, symptoms, and delay clinical worsening. It is delivered via a specialized nebulizer (the I-neb AAD System) directly into the lungs, producing rapid dilation of pulmonary blood vessels. Because the effect of each inhaled dose lasts only a few hours, Ventavis must be inhaled 6 to 9 times per day during waking hours. It is typically used when patients are inadequately controlled on other PAH therapies.

Patient assistance programs

Johnson & Johnson Patient Assistance Program (J&J withMe)

Manufacturer PAP
Eligibility
Uninsured or underinsured adults with a valid Ventavis prescription from a licensed U.S. healthcare provider who meet income requirements.
Income limit
Varies based on household size; generally ≤400% of Federal Poverty Level (FPL)
Insurance
Uninsured or underinsured
